Frequently Asked Questions

What should I consider when choosing a custom wedding dress designer? +

When choosing a custom wedding dress designer, a client should consider the designer's portfolio to assess if their style aligns with her vision. The designer's experience and reputation in the industry are also worth considering, with more experienced designers often producing more reliable and high-quality work. Another factor to take into account is the designer's pricing and if it fits within the client's budget, as well as their turnaround time to ensure the dress will be ready by the wedding date. The client should also consider the type of fabrics the designer uses, as this can affect the look and feel of the dress. Finally, it's beneficial to have open communication with the designer to ensure that they understand the client's vision and can make adjustments as needed.

How much does it generally cost to have a wedding dress custom-made? +

Custom-made wedding dresses can vary significantly in cost based on the complexity of the design and the quality of the materials used. Generally, prices can range anywhere from $1,500 to over $10,000, with most brides spending an average of around $2,500 to $3,000 on their custom design. This cost includes consultations, fittings, fabric, embellishments, and the designer's labor, but remember, it can increase if you opt for high-end materials or intricate detailing.

What is the process of working with a custom wedding dress designer? +

The process of working with a custom wedding dress designer typically begins with a consultation, where the bride and designer discuss ideas, style preferences, and budget. After this initial meeting, the designer creates sketches or renders and the bride chooses her favorite design. The designer then takes accurate measurements of the bride to ensure a perfect fit. There are usually several fittings involved, with the dress being adjusted each time to refine the fit. The designer and bride may also select fabrics, lace, beading, or other embellishments together. It's a collaborative process that requires time, patience, and open communication. Keep in mind that custom dresses are usually more expensive than off-the-rack options and require more lead time, sometimes up to a year in advance.

Can a custom wedding dress designer recreate a design I saw somewhere else? +

Yes, a custom wedding dress designer can often recreate a design that a client has seen elsewhere. However, the accuracy of the reproduction will depend on the complexity of the design, the skills of the designer, and the availability of similar materials. It's also important to respect copyright and intellectual property laws, so direct copies of designer dresses may not be possible or ethical. It's more common for designers to use an existing design as inspiration, incorporating key elements into a unique creation that suits the client's body shape, taste, and wedding theme.

Can I bring in my own material for a custom wedding dress? +

The possibility of bringing in your own material for a custom wedding dress largely depends on the policies of the specific designer you choose. Some designers are open to this idea and will gladly work with the fabric you provide, while others may prefer to source their own materials, ensuring they meet their quality standards and are suitable for the design you have in mind. It's always best to discuss this directly with your designer before making any decisions to avoid misunderstandings or disappointments.

Can I make changes to the design once the dressmaking process has started? +

In the world of custom wedding dress design, alterations to the design once the dressmaking process has begun can be possible, but it often depends on the specific designer and how far along the process is. Some designers are flexible and open to modifications, while others may charge extra fees or refuse changes completely once the initial design has been approved. It's crucial to discuss these details and any potential charges with your designer before the process begins to avoid any surprises or disappointments.

How many fittings will I need for a custom-made wedding dress? +

Typically, a bride-to-be can expect to have around three to five fittings for a custom-made wedding dress. This number can fluctuate based on the complexity of the dress design and the bride's unique body shape. It's important to understand that more fittings may be necessary if significant alterations are required, making it crucial to start the custom dress process well in advance of the wedding date.

What should I prepare or know before my first meeting with a custom wedding dress designer? +

Before a first meeting with a custom wedding dress designer, one should have an idea of their preferred style, budget, and timeline. Photos or sketches of desired designs can be helpful to communicate the vision. Understanding fabric types, embellishments, and silhouette styles can also be beneficial, though the designer will guide through these details. It's realistic to know that custom gowns usually take several months to create and tend to be more expensive than off-the-rack options.

What is the difference between a custom wedding dress and a ready-made one? +

A custom wedding dress is designed and sewn specifically for the bride, taking into consideration her unique measurements, preferences, and desired style. This often involves several fittings and adjustments to ensure the perfect fit. On the other hand, a ready-made wedding dress is a pre-designed and pre-sized gown that is purchased off the rack. While these gowns can be altered to better fit the bride, they do not offer the same level of personalization as custom dresses.

Can a custom wedding dress designer accommodate special requests, such as eco-friendly materials or specific cultural elements? +

Yes, a custom wedding dress designer can generally accommodate special requests such as using eco-friendly materials or incorporating specific cultural elements into the design. The degree to which they can fulfill these requests, however, often depends on the designer's experience, resources, and expertise. For instance, a designer with experience in working with sustainable materials will be more adept at creating an eco-friendly gown, while those with a background in various cultural designs can better incorporate specific cultural elements. It's important for customers to discuss their specific needs and expectations with the designer upfront to ensure a satisfactory outcome.
